For the second straight game, Morse will face off against La Jolla. The Tigers will be playing at home against the Vikings at 4:00 p.m. on Wednesday. Morse has now lost nine straight, leaving the team hunting for their first win since March 21.
Morse fell victim to La Jolla and their airtight pitching crew on Monday. They lost 12-0 to the Vikings. While getting shut out isn't ideal, the Tigers haven't been shut out since back in March.
For La Jolla's part, they let Luke Cripe and Reed Turner run wild. Cripe went 2-for-3 with two runs and one RBI, while Turner went 2-for-4 with three RBI, two runs, and one double. Those two hits gave Cripe a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Zach Gergurich, who went 1-for-3 with two RBI, one run, and one double.
La Jolla has been performing well recently as they've won three of their last four contests. That's provided a nice bump to their 9-11 record this season. Those victories came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 10.8 runs over those games. As for Morse, their loss dropped their record down to 3-14.
